      Cup Diameter

      The Marcinkiewicz 9 has a cup diameter of 17.58 mm / 0.6921 in compared to 17.53 mm / 0.6900 in on the Curry 9F — a difference of 0.05 mm / 0.0021 in. A wider cup generally produces a fuller, darker tone but requires more air support.

      Cup Depth

      Both mouthpieces share a medium cup depth, so the sound character from depth alone will be very similar.

      Throat Diameter

      The Marcinkiewicz 9 has a wider throat (4.98 mm / 0.1961 in vs 4.57 mm / 0.1800 in). A wider throat allows more air through, increasing volume and projection but reducing resistance.
